Standards

How these records are compiled

Each edition record starts from coverage published at the time of that edition. Attendance and economic figures carry an explicit measure type and the party that produced them, and unlike figures are never merged into a single series. Where sources disagree, both figures are shown. Nothing is estimated, interpolated or filled in.

Individual roles are recorded only for editions where a source names the person in that role. Where ownership or operation changed hands, the record says so on the editions affected. Media is published only with a named creator and a link to the archive it came from. See the methodology for the standards this follows; full source ledgers sit at the foot of every archive page.
